Senate Screening: Seven ministerial nominees “Take a bow-and-go”
The Senate has begun the screening of Ministerial Nominees sent to it last week by President Bola Tinubu for subsequent confirmation.
With the commencement, fourteen out of the twenty-eight nominees that were screened, even as out of the fourteen, seven were asked to take a bow and go, with others drilled for some minutes where they were asked questions relating to security, infrastructure, issue of date of birth, among others.
Those who enjoyed the bow and go syndrome were a two- term of House of Representatives, Honourable Abubakar Momoh from Etsako Local Government Area of Edo State; Senator Abubakar Kyari, who was in the 8th and 9th Senate and presently the Acting National of the ruling All Progressives Congress, APC; former Governor of Rivers State, Nyesom Wike; a Senator in the 8th Senate, Senator John Enoh; and the immediate Governor of Jigawa State, Abubakar Badaru.
Others who were asked to take a bow and go were and former Deputy Chief Whip of the House of Representatives, Nkiru Onyejiocha who represented Isuikwuato/ Umunneochi Federal Constituency, Abia State; former member, House of Representatives and Nigeria Ambassador to Germany, since 2017, Amb. Yusuf Maitama Tuggar.
